OSDN Git Service

spi: spi-fsl-dspi: Add support for XSPI mode registers
authorEsben Haabendal <eha@deif.com>
Wed, 20 Jun 2018 07:34:38 +0000 (09:34 +0200)
committerMark Brown <broonie@kernel.org>
Wed, 20 Jun 2018 13:48:02 +0000 (14:48 +0100)
commit58ba07ec79e62054dd2b2f1cea082a542aa01c44
treeac66cd0cbb4931449d2cfb5bae1918a60e6a4850
parent071db7a6759d5d0a85ecf6a600ac1f9caa7f6404
spi: spi-fsl-dspi: Add support for XSPI mode registers

This prepares for adding support for extended SPI mode (XSPI), by extending
the regmap with the extra SREX and CTAREx registers.

An additional register map is made for allowing 16 bit access to CMD and TX
FIFO of the PUSHR register separately, which is also needed for XSPI mode
support.

Signed-off-by: Esben Haabendal <eha@deif.com>
Acked-by: Martin Hundebøll <martin@geanix.com>
Signed-off-by: Mark Brown <broonie@kernel.org>
drivers/spi/spi-fsl-dspi.c